Originally Posted by seafish
Well I guess I'll just step right into this--


MORE smoke=wasted fuel=LESS power

It's simple chemistry!!!
Thats partially true, but not necessarily less power. If a truck is smoking, you know that it is burning the most possible fuel it can at that RPM and boost level, and thus making the most power. Wasteful yes, less power not necessarily. It is true that its less power in the fact that if you added more air you would have more burned fuel, and thus, more power.
